Python package implementing minimal binary coding.
Project description
Python package implementing minimal binary coding.
How do I install this package?
As usual, just download it using pip:
pip install minimal_binary_coding
Tests Coverage
Since some software handling coverages sometime get slightly different results, here’s three of them:
Usage examples
from minimal_binary_coding import minimal_binary_coding
minimal_binary_coding(0, 1) # ε
minimal_binary_coding(0, 2) # 0
minimal_binary_coding(1, 2) # 1
minimal_binary_coding(0, 3) # 0
minimal_binary_coding(1, 3) # 10
minimal_binary_coding(2, 3) # 11
minimal_binary_coding(0, 4) # 00
minimal_binary_coding(1, 4) # 01
minimal_binary_coding(2, 4) # 10
minimal_binary_coding(3, 4) # 11
minimal_binary_coding(0, 5) # 00
minimal_binary_coding(1, 5) # 01
minimal_binary_coding(2, 5) # 10
minimal_binary_coding(3, 5) # 110
minimal_binary_coding(4, 5) # 111
minimal_binary_coding(0, 6) # 00
minimal_binary_coding(1, 6) # 01
minimal_binary_coding(2, 6) # 100
minimal_binary_coding(3, 6) # 101
minimal_binary_coding(4, 6) # 110
minimal_binary_coding(5, 6) # 111
minimal_binary_coding(0, 7) # 00
minimal_binary_coding(1, 7) # 010
minimal_binary_coding(2, 7) # 011
minimal_binary_coding(3, 7) # 100
minimal_binary_coding(4, 7) # 101
minimal_binary_coding(5, 7) # 110
minimal_binary_coding(6, 7) # 111
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Close
Hashes for minimal_binary_coding-1.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| d9d9aa67e9954e3eb6b36f32ef201f741f434c181d2687817f94ce8bafc49e1e |
|
MD5 | d697e4bf44c96b98562a90211fd27738 |
|
BLAKE2b-256 | 622065206e318e0e2d33a6769503251751842a24b2210cc1a2dc0b3eb5d34235 |